Biography

James F. Early graduated from Harvard College and received his law degree from Boston University School of Law. Focusing his practice on representing asbestos victims, Mr. Early has successfully represented thousands of workers who contracted diseases from occupational exposure to asbestos. The State Courts of Connecticut appointed him as lead counsel for plaintiffs filing lawsuits for asbestos diseases and for poisoning due to lead paint.

Mr. Early has been recognized by two of the best lawyer rating systems in the U.S. He has been selected for inclusion in the oldest lawyer rating publication, Best Lawyers. He has also been named "Super Lawyer" by the Super Lawyers rating service in recognition of his professional achievement and the high degree of peer recognition that he has earned throughout his career. No more than 5 percent of the lawyers in any given state are awarded this prestigious designation.

Mr. Early is a member of the Connecticut, New York, New Hampshire, and New Haven County Bar Associations; the American Association for Justice; and the Connecticut Trial Lawyers Association.
